To underpin a home or structure one must extend the current foundation into a ground strata or layer that's deeper and more secure than the current earth that the foundation is resting upon. This is accomplished by supplying additional support from the current footing or wall via piers or anchors. Procedures of foundation repairs contain force piers, plate anchors, helical anchors or drilled concrete piles. The people responsible for designing and instituting these procedures include foundation engineers and foundation repair contractors. A foundation engineer is responsible to assess the structure in question and then provide a suggestion for his design.

But mold development is not the only dangerous consequence of basement moisture. The construction of your home can also be compromised. Signs of a moisture issue contains peeling paint, corroding pipes, cracked or bowed walls, and even soft, rotting wood. Once you see these surface issues, odds are you've got a bigger issue behind the walls. Bring in a basement contractor to evaluate the situation and take steps to immediately repair any shaky structures.

There are many possible causes of water damage to your basement. The most common cause is the chance of having land that has a flat or negative slope. This will cause water to pool and gather against your foundation. Another possibility is that the builder of your house didn't properly waterproof your foundation.

Basement waterproofing - A common, very effective process of basement waterproofing is called the French drain system. First, a sump pump installation is performed, and then a trench that's pitched toward the sump pump is excavated along the interior perimeter of the basement. This trench is full of a large perforated conduit and then covered over with a spot of concrete. This conduit collects the water that runs toward your home and enters along the wall/floor seal and directs it to the pump, which then pushes it out of the basement and away from your home.
